Android programming courses can help you learn Java and Kotlin, app lifecycle management, user interface design, and database integration. You can build skills in debugging, performance optimization, and implementing APIs for enhanced functionality. Many courses introduce tools like Android Studio for development, Firebase for backend services, and Git for version control, allowing you to create robust applications and collaborate effectively on projects.

Skills you'll gain: Generative AI, Generative Model Architectures, Generative Adversarial Networks (GANs), Responsible AI, Applied Machine Learning, Data Ethics, Transfer Learning, Artificial Intelligence, Model Optimization, Federated Learning, Machine Learning Methods, Scalability, Machine Learning, Distributed Computing, Microsoft Azure, Information Privacy
★ 4.7 (45) · Intermediate · Course · 1 - 4 Weeks

University of Michigan
Skills you'll gain: Debugging, Unit Testing, Relational Databases, Object Oriented Programming (OOP), Data Visualization, Data Store, Web Scraping, Database Management, Creative Design, Data Structures, Scatter Plots, Data Manipulation, Programming Principles, File I/O, Test Case, Software Visualization, Python Programming, Computer Programming, Program Development, Diversity and Inclusion
★ 3.8 (14) · Intermediate · Specialization · 3 - 6 Months

Nanjing University
Skills you'll gain: C (Programming Language), Computer Systems, Data Structures, System Programming, System Software, Programming Principles, Computer Architecture, Computer Programming, Secure Coding, Operating Systems, Hardware Architecture, Data Storage, Memory Management, Computer Hardware, Application Security, Build Tools
★ 4.7 (59) · Mixed · Course · 1 - 3 Months

Birla Institute of Technology & Science, Pilani
Skills you'll gain: Operating Systems, Operating System Administration, Memory Management, OS Process Management, System Software, System Programming, Command-Line Interface, Linux Administration, File Systems, System Monitoring, Performance Tuning, Package and Software Management, Systems Architecture, File Management, Algorithms, Cloud Platforms, User Accounts, Security Controls, Data Sharing
★ 4.9 (11) · Intermediate · Course · 1 - 3 Months

Skills you'll gain: Plotly, Interactive Data Visualization, Plot (Graphics), Data Visualization Software, Ggplot2, Exploratory Data Analysis, Data Analysis, Python Programming, Data Science, Machine Learning
★ 4.7 (269) · Intermediate · Guided Project · Less Than 2 Hours

University of Michigan
Skills you'll gain: Unsupervised Learning, Data Mining, Social Network Analysis, ChatGPT, Embeddings, LLM Application, Applied Machine Learning, Data Quality, Unstructured Data, Anomaly Detection, Machine Learning Methods, Data Science, Supervised Learning, Machine Learning, Data Preprocessing, Data Analysis, Social Media Analytics, Data Manipulation, Python Programming, Exploratory Data Analysis
★ 4.6 (18) · Advanced · Specialization · 3 - 6 Months

Johns Hopkins University
Skills you'll gain: R (Software), R Programming, Statistical Programming, Statistical Software, Statistical Analysis, Statistical Methods, Debugging, File I/O, Data Analysis, Simulations, Programming Principles, Data Import/Export, Data Processing, Data Structures, Data Manipulation, Computer Programming, Performance Tuning, Software Installation
Intermediate · Course · 1 - 4 Weeks

Vanderbilt University
Skills you'll gain: Excel Macros, Excel Formulas, Microsoft Excel, Data Visualization, ChatGPT, Plot (Graphics), Spreadsheet Software, Interactive Data Visualization, AI Enablement, Multimodal Prompts, Generative AI, Prototyping, Verification And Validation
★ 4.8 (74) · Beginner · Course · 1 - 4 Weeks

Board Infinity
Skills you'll gain: ASP.NET, .NET Framework, C# (Programming Language), Object Oriented Programming (OOP), Web Development, Web Applications, Object Oriented Design, Application Frameworks, Programming Principles, Event-Driven Programming
★ 4.1 (34) · Beginner · Course · 1 - 4 Weeks

Skills you'll gain: SAS (Software), Case Studies, Data Processing, Automation, Statistical Programming, Data Manipulation, Code Reusability, Data Validation
★ 4.8 (150) · Intermediate · Course · 1 - 3 Months

Unilever
Skills you'll gain: Descriptive Analytics, Supply Chain, Supply Chain Management, Supply Chain Systems, Supply Chain Planning, Predictive Analytics, Forecasting, Inventory Management System, Statistical Programming, Query Languages, Data-Driven Decision-Making, Business Analytics, Advanced Analytics, Analytics, Predictive Modeling, Inventory Control, Agile Methodology, SQL, Data Presentation, Descriptive Statistics
★ 4.7 (67) ·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Product Planning, Commercialization, Customer Insights, Product Management, Verification And Validation, Quality Assessment, Product Improvement, Research and Design, Manufacturing and Production, Product Lifecycle Management, Feasibility Studies, Quality Control, Manufacturing Standards, Ideation, Good Manufacturing Practices, Compliance Management, Ethical Standards And Conduct
★ 4.7 (74) · Beginner · Course · 1 - 4 Weeks